[The Workers’ Party - Team East Coast] The Blk 216 Bedok Food Centre & Market, a place often frequented by many residents who live in the East - including Aljunied GRC residents who reside in Bedok Reservoir and Bedok North - has been in the news over the last few weeks from around the Labour Day weekend. Three tuberculosis (TB) clusters with a total of 13 genetically similar cases isolated to three locations in Bedok Central dating from January 2023 to February 2026 triggered a TB screening protocol. The news saw many members of the public avoiding the market and hawker centre, even though there was no instruction or guidance to indicate that it was unsafe to visit and to partake in some superb hawker fare, or to visit Bedok Central in general. The Workers’ Party East Coast team of @jasperkuanwp @parisvwp @sufyanmp.wp and @yeejennjong dropped in to the hawker centre over the weekend following the annoucement of the TB screening to show their support for the hawkers and stall owners who were badly affected by the loss of business, while WP Organising Secretary @dennistanlf_wp and I dropped in after, and through the course of last week, to do the same. I had lunch at the hawker centre today, and it was certainly good to see the public keeping calm and carrying on! If the specified locations at Bedok Central are places you visited often from January 2023 (i.e. you spent a cumulative 96 hours in a year [equivalent to two hours per week or eight hours per month]), do consider free voluntary TB screening (up to 6 Jun 2026) as a precautionary measure. #TeamEastCoast visited the Simei Street 4 neighbourhood this evening. Great to catch up with residents as we approach the weekend. While many were generally in a relaxed mood, some residents shared their anxieties on how recent geopolitical conflicts may soon affect their kitchen tables. Daily expenses are rising, as fuel costs are impacted. Food prices are naturally the next worry. Nevertheless, we all share a common hope that peace will soon prevail. Locally, some residents were concerned about the increasing risk of mosquito breeding areas in the neighbourhood, particularly around the common areas. Heartening to know that the NEA are responding to their concerns and we hope that this is also resolved soon. It goes unsaid, that it’s the little things that matter. We sincerely appreciate the residents who went out of their way to hand us some drinks as we made our way through their corridors and staircases. Thank you for sharing your evening with us.
